About the Book

Competence and perceived competence are outcomes of two things: one's actual skill level, and the way in which one communicates one's achievements and points of view to others. The first is domain-specific, but the second of these is very interesting. It is easier to communicate in one's first language than in one's second language. In the globally connected world in which we live, it is imperative that those of us who rely upon English as a Second Language are able to use every resource available to communicate all our wisdom effectively, so as to avoid any negative consequences to our all-important career prospects. This book is all about that. There are many students of English as a Second Language who display so much burgeoning proficiency that their teachers feel like changing the Second in the title to First. This book is meant for students who are gifted, or who aspire to be gifted. They are far ahead of their peer group, and wish to make the step to true native proficiency in the English language. Pretty much every country that is not made up of a majority of English speakers has a huge number of English teachers who help the most talented people in these countries use the world's most popular language to get ahead in their personal and professional lives. Whether you need English to follow your favorite movies and shows, or to get that job that will supercharge your career, this book will definitely help you! ESL Prep is a tough, sometimes frustrating, but ultimately rewarding skill. You can see yourself level up step by step as you learn each new word, and the happiness you feel as you get a little better every day is only matched by the professional success you will experience when you reach the summit of achievement. It is very important to get things right at the first of a learner's language journey. Do it right, and the student will be able to get ahead in the most convenient possible way. Get it wrong, and it will take a long time to repair the damage. This book will help ESL and TEFL teachers get it right. It is primarily targeted at advanced learners of English as a Second Language, and features words that are challenging. There are many apps and games that help us learn languages in a fun and exciting way. From the gamification inherent in apps like Duolingo and Rosetta Stone, to more traditional approaches in brick and mortar language classes, language learning has always seen a variety of pedagogical approaches. This book offers an interesting - and successful - new take on the age-old problem of building up one's vocabulary in a new language quickly and at minimal cost. Learning English has many aspects: it is important to learn basic grammar and sentence structure. It is also very important to have a large bank of words to draw from, so that you can understand all the important parts of a conversation, and also so that you can read a book or watch a movie and follow most of what's going on without needing to use a dictionary or rely too heavily on the subtitles. Within this book, you will learn hundreds of new English words through the medium of multiple fun and engaging word game formats.
